Abstract
The wind turbine has two vaned rotors fitted on horizontal shafts (23) rotatably fitted in a bearing component (10). This component is connected to a rotatably located vertical output shaft (15). The rotor shafts project radially on diametrally opposite sides of this shaft. The rotor shafts have gearwheels (25) for engagement with a gear ring (26) coaxial with the output shaft. - The bearing component comprises an oil-tight gear housing (10) enclosing the gearwheels and connected at the top to the upper end of the output shaft. At the bottom, the component is rotatably located on a further component (16) connected to the gear ring.(2)
